About Me:
I love to design, build and love to Cruise big sail boats. I have been playing with sail boats for over fifty years and beginning to learn the basics of sailing.

My present boat was used hard for about fifteen years, chartering and cruising. The boat is a great boat for blue water cruising. So instead of replacing it, I am restoring the boat to better than new.

To see more photos etc, visit my web site www.paulalfrey.com

Soon, I hope to head back to the Tropics again. New Zealand would be fun.
